Handling Pain and Pain



You need to take over-the-counter discomfort drug to help take care of any kind of pain you might experience after your oral implant procedure. It's common to experience some degree of pain or discomfort following the surgical treatment. Taking over-the-counter pain drug, such as advil or acetaminophen, can help ease any kind of post-operative pain. Make sure to adhere to the recommended dose guidelines and consult with your dental expert or pharmacologist if you have any kind of problems.

Additionally, using an ice bag to the afflicted location for 15 minutes each time can help reduce swelling and provide short-term alleviation. It is very important to rest and prevent strenuous activities for the initial couple of days to permit your body to heal.

Oral Hygiene and Cleaning Techniques



Preserving proper dental health and on a regular basis cleaning your oral implant are necessary for an effective healing.

After obtaining an oral implant, it's important to follow proper dental hygiene methods to make sure the durability and health and wellness of your dental implant. Brush your teeth at the very least two times a day using a soft-bristled toothbrush and a non-abrasive toothpaste. Be gentle around the implant location to prevent causing any damage.

Furthermore, flossing is essential to get rid of plaque and food particles that can collect around the implant. Use a floss threader or interdental brush to clean between the implant and nearby teeth.

Furthermore, washing with an antimicrobial mouth wash can help in reducing microorganisms and maintain oral wellness.

Dietary Considerations and Restrictions



When it pertains to your diet regimen after obtaining a dental implant, it is necessary to be mindful of particular factors to consider and constraints. While you might be eager to go back to your regular consuming habits, it's essential to provide your implant time to recover appropriately.

In the first couple of days after surgical procedure, you need to stay with a soft or fluid diet regimen to stay clear of putting too much pressure on the implant site. This suggests preventing hard, crunchy, or sticky foods that might potentially displace or harm the implant. It's likewise a good idea to stay clear of warm foods and beverages, as they can increase discomfort and swelling.

As your dental implant heals, you can progressively reintroduce solid foods, but be cautious and chew on the contrary side of your mouth to stay clear of any unnecessary stress on the dental implant. Remember to follow any kind of particular dietary guidelines provided by your dental practitioner and talk to them if you have any type of concerns.
